🌳 Meadowlark Park & Jerry Baxa Outdoor Lab

Nestled directly behind Meadowlark Ridge Elementary at 443 Beechwood Road, Meadowlark Park features a charming gazebo, walking paths, and the Jerry Baxa Outdoor Lab nature area, making it a beautiful natural retreat and an educational resource right within the neighborhood.

🏫 Meadowlark Ridge Elementary School

Located at 2200 Glen Avenue, Meadowlark Ridge Elementary is the neighborhood’s beloved PK–5 school with a long history, all‑day kindergarten, a science lab, secure entry and a strong community culture fostering family‑style traditions.

⚾ Berkley Family Recreational Area

Just minutes from Meadowlark Ridge, at 841 Markley Road, the Berkley Family Recreational Area offers lighted baseball and softball diamonds, playgrounds, disc golf, dog park, shelters and hosts community sporting events and annual celebrations.

⛳ Salina Municipal Golf Course

At 2500 East Crawford, this family‑friendly municipal golf facility near Meadowlark Ridge offers an 18‑hole regulation course, a 6‑hole short course, driving range, putting and short game areas with country‑club quality turf at affordable green fees.
